For the Inspiration Challenge, we're headed to Cute Tape. They have lots of cute washi tapes, & I chose THIS for my inspiration. The grid pattern reminded me of the stamp I used for the background so I built my card around it.
The large bg image was put into my Misti & inked first w/ a combination of the lt blue & lt teal inks. Then I wiped that ink off, & dabbed white pigment on in spots & stamped again. It was coated w/ a clear, sparkly powder & heat embossed. For the greeting circle, I stamped it w/ a dk blue pigment ink & the circle frame around it, I used a teal pigment ink. Both were heat embossed w/ the same powder. For the line of trees, after die cutting, I took the white ink & smooshed it over the trees & heat embossed. I die cut a bunch of the stitched hills & the colored up gnomes then put it all together.
